Import duties and VAT apply to any shipment with a goods value (FOB) exceeding $3.00 USD. Once this threshold is crossed, taxes are calculated on the total cost including shipping and insurance.
No, the $500 limit mentioned in travel guides only applies to items you carry personally as a passenger, not to shipments. Forwarded packages follow 'consignment' rules where taxes start at just $3.00 USD.
You can estimate costs by adding 7.5% duty and 11% VAT to your total CIF value, then adding a carrier handling fee of roughly $3.00 to $10.00 USD. Keep in mind that final charges are determined by Indonesian customs and the specific HS codes of your items.
Most consumer goods valued between $3.00 and $1,500 USD incur a simplified flat duty rate of 7.5% on the total CIF value. Be aware that textiles, shoes, and bags often face higher specific rates ranging from 15% to 30%.
Your shipment is subject to an 11% Value Added Tax (PPN) calculated on the CIF value plus the customs duty amount. This rate applies to almost all imports once the $3.00 threshold is exceeded.
Yes, carriers like DHL or FedEx typically charge a handling fee between IDR 50,000 and IDR 150,000 (~$3.00 – $10.00 USD) for processing your package. This fee is separate from the government duties and VAT you owe.
Indonesian customs calculate taxes on the CIF value, which includes the cost of goods plus insurance and freight charges to Indonesia. The duty is applied first, and then VAT is calculated on the sum of the CIF value and that duty.
Providing your local Tax ID (NPWP) or National ID (NIK) to the carrier can help prevent clearance delays for your package. While simplified rules exist for consignment shipments, having these details ready ensures smoother processing.
No, books are often exempt from customs duty, while cosmetics may face high HS-code specific rates unlike the standard 7.5% flat rate for general goods. Always check the specific category of your items as luxury or restricted goods have different rules.
The Directorate General of Customs and Excise (Bea Cukai) determines the final charges, but they are usually collected by your carrier upon delivery. You will typically pay these fees directly to the courier before receiving your shipment.
